Norman Pilcher, the drug cop who arrested John Lennon, Brian Jones or George Harrison, recalls their rise and fall in his memoirs


To paraphrase the poet, his name poisoned dreams, the dreams of beautiful people.

The stars of Swinging London were convinced that a bogeyman was on their trail.

A policeman who did not fail: he raided your home and, if he did not find incriminating material, Norman Pilcher made, hocus pocus, some prohibited substance appear.

In 1967, the hallucinated

I Am The Walrus came out

, where John Lennon made fun of a certain "Semolina Pilchard".
